I am using Keepnote v. 0.7.8. I have been trying to open an older file but am told it needs to be updated from v4 to v6. However, when I try doing that it says it can't open it because the version is too old. I have quite a bit of information in that older file, how can I get it into the new version format?

Besides that problem and it being slow at times, this is a great program. I have moved all my browser bookmarks to a notebook and just leave Keepnote open when I have my browser open. There are so many uses for the software.
